Results of abdominal VS-IR MRA from protocol (ii). Representative coronal MIP images from three subjects show excellent visualization of the abdominal aorta, renal arteries, and iliac arteries throughout the entire S/I FOV. Background signals are well suppressed except in the intestine that contains short T1 contents. Excellent arterial contrast and overall background suppression were achieved using a relatively short TI of 700 ms due to well-preserved arterial blood in the abdominal aorta and iliac arteries during the VS preparation.
